Abstract


For a Banach space E of density equal to the cardinality of the smallest uncountable ordinal number ω1 and having a projectional resolution of the identity (in short, PRI), it is proved that there is a norming subspace V of E* such that the unit bail of V is σ(V,E)-angelic. In addition, if the PRI is of a special type called type I, then an Odell-Rosenthal type characterization is obtained for the non-containment of a copy of l1 in E.
